The present participle

1.
  • I am going to school.
  • I was waiting you for a long time.

2.
  • Teaching is hard work.
  • Smocking is not allowed in this cinema.
  • The beginning of the lesson was not difficult.
  • Judge told the thief,"Telling lies won't help you,"

3.
  • When did you begin learning English?
  • The teacher said, " Don't ask questions yet. I haven't finished speaking."
  • Children learn reading and writing at school.
  • It has stopped raining and the sun is shining.
  • Jack likes swimming in the summer, but he hates swimming when the weather is cold.
  • I shall never forget going to the place and meeting the King.
  • I can't remember locking the door.
4.
  • I was tired of listening to the wireless, so I turned it off.
  • Tom  got up early and finished his home work before going to school.
  • He tore up the letter after reading it.
  • Bob's father punished him for telling a lie.
  • Jack is reading a book about hunting lions in Africa.
  • When Ahmad went to London, he learnt to speak English well by living with an English family.
  • She went out of the shop without buying anything.
5.
  • Look! There is a man hiding behind the door.
  • Is there anyone living in that old house?
  • There are more than a thousand men working in the factory.
  • Are there a lot of people waiting outside the cinema?
6.
  • Mary didn't hear the bell ringing.
  • The people are looking at the soldiers marching.
  • I have never seen Henry wearing a hat.
  • The teacher caught two pupils cheating.
  • We listened to the birds singing.
  • The policeman found the thief hiding under the bed.
7. Adjectives
  • a dying man
  • A crying baby
  • a growing boy
  • a burning house
  • a sinking ship
  • boiling water
  • falling leaves
